Ford Motor Credit Company (“Ford Credit”) has received regulatory conditional approval to form Ford Credit Bank (the “Bank”), to be headquartered in Salt Lake City, Utah. The Bank will create innovative and simplified banking solutions to help customers across the country finance the purchase of new Ford vehicles, parts, accessories, EV Infrastructure and software and will accept deposits with competitive rates on FDIC-insured savings accounts and certificates of deposit. The Bank will be a direct and wholly owned subsidiary of Ford Credit, an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of Ford Motor Company (“Ford”).

The successful candidate will be a member of an exciting and dynamic team of banking professionals who would have the opportunity to stand up and begin the operations of the de novo Bank. New employees hired by the bank will initially be Ford Credit employees. Once the bank is formally established, these employees may be transferred to the new bank.

In this position...

Play a vital role in an exciting and dynamic team of banking professionals to stand up and begin operations of the de novo Bank. The Model Risk Management (MRM) Lead will be the technical subject matter expert for the models and analytics used to run the Bank. You will gain broad exposure across credit scoring, pricing, collections, financial crimes, expected credit loss methodologies, and more. This individual will report directly to the Bank’s Director of MRM and will assist in the execution of the MRM program in compliance with the Bank’s policy and procedures and regulatory expectations. The MRM Lead will ensure the appropriate identification, assessment, validation, and ongoing monitoring of models and quantitative methodologies.
